Instalace Postfix Dovecot SASL Centos 7
Budu pokračovat v instalaci z konfigurace v předchozím příspěvku. Naistalujeme si Dovecot a zprovozníme si připojení k protokolu POP3 na serveru ze vzdáleného PC. Pro přihlášení použijeme SASL.
upravíme konfiguraci Postfixu
1 2 3 4 5 6 7 8 |
vi /etc/postfix/main.cf smtpd_sasl_type = dovecot smtpd_sasl_path = private/auth smtpd_sasl_auth_enable = yes broken_sasl_auth_clients = yes smtpd_sasl_security_options = noanonymous smtpd_relay_restrictions = permit_mynetworks, permit_sasl_authenticated, reject_unauth_destination |
instalujeme a konfigurujeme dovecot
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 |
yum install dovecot vi /etc/dovecot/dovecot.conf protocols = pop3 imap lmtp listen * vi /etc/dovecot/conf.d/10-auth.conf disable_plaintext_auth = no auth_mechanisms = plain login vi /etc/dovecot/conf.d/10-mail.conf mail_location = maildir:~/Maildir vi /etc/dovecot/conf.d/10-master.conf unix_listener /var/spool/postfix/private/auth { mode = 0666 user = postfix group = postfix } vi /etc/dovecot/conf.d/10-ssl.conf ssl = no |
1 2 3 4 5 6 |
systemctl start dovecot.service sytemctl enable dovecot.service systemctl restart postfix.service firewall-cmd --ad-zone=public --add-port=110/tcp --permanent firewall-cmd --reload |
Otestujeme telnetem a můžeme nakonfigurovat připojení k mailovému účtu v e-mail klientovi. jeden problém, ale máme a to je, že helso běhá posíti v plaintextu. To bychom měli eleiminovat použitím TLS. A to zase v příštím pokračování.